Abstract

The utility model relates to a porcelain granule bath device which comprises a bathtub and a heating plant. The wall of the bathtub is provided with a plurality of heating through holes which are connected with the heating plant through a heating pipeline, and porcelain granules are filled in the bathtub. The porcelain granule bath device has simple structure, low manufacture cost, durability and intensive control, can cause the temperature of the bath sand layer to rise quickly and cause each position in the bath sand layer to be evenly heated and to keep constant temperature continuously; in addition, the porcelain granule bath device adopts the bath sand layer composed of porcelain granules containing similar components with lava, thereby not only enabling the sand bath process to be more comfortable, but also having better hairdressing, health-care and health preserving efficiency and easy cleaning. Meanwhile, the porcelain granule bath device adopts the circulating mode to heat the bath sand layer so as to have high heating efficiency and save the energy; and the bath sand layer is cleaned, so the sand bath process is safer and more sanitary. The utility model can be widely applied to various medical as well as hairdressing and health-care occasions.

Background technology
Psammotherapy claims again " hot sand therapy ", mainly is to be mediator with river shoal, the clean sand grains in seabeach, whole body or part body and affected part is imbedded in the sand, by conducting heat and mechanism, to reach cure the disease a kind of therapy of effect of aesthetic health care and health preserving.At present, used bath sand mainly comprises fluvial sand, sea sand and field sand etc. in the psammotherapy commonly used, and the method for heating bath sand mainly comprises natural heating and artificial heating.Bathing sand in these psammotherapy is normally obtained after bulk processing by the natural grains of sand, though it is comparatively cheap and easy to get, but its morphological differences is big, the particle diameter heterogeneity, and it is less usually, be difficult to handle, so bathing, this class directly abandons after the processing mode of sand typically uses, or repeatedly use and do not changed, in these two kinds of processing modes, the former can cause the husky cost for the treatment of higher, easily causes the wasting of resources, and easily causes environmental pollution, it is extremely unhygienic that the latter then causes bathing sand usually, easily makes user skin infection disease etc.In addition, these methods need can be carried out under specific geography and weather condition usually, or need operation after can carry out loaded down with trivial details early stage usually, and bathe the temperature mutability of sand in the sand therapy process, often cause user to do not feel like oneself.
The Chinese patent publication number is CN2728477, open day to be the patent of invention of 2005.09.28, a kind of far infrared sand-bath device is proposed, this sand-bath device has sand-bath pond, heat-generating pipe and sand bed, be provided with metallic plate and heat-insulation layer below the sand bed, metallic plate is provided with the heating tube seat, heat-generating pipe is embedded in the heating tube seat, and the upper surface of metallic plate is provided with the far-infrared ray ceramic layer.Though this sand-bath device can make sand bed heat up rapidly in the short period of time, but because of what adopt is the radiant heat transfer mode, the more difficult usually homogeneous of the temperature at diverse location place in the sand bed, and heat easily runs off from sand-bath pond upper opening and casing wall etc. in heating process and in the sand-bath process.Simultaneously, this sand-bath apparatus cost is higher, and because of heat-generating pipe is easily aging, easily damaged, so service life is limited.In addition, in this sand-bath device, bathe sand after using, clean inconvenience, after repeatedly using, shelter evil people and countenance evil practices easily, very unhygienic.

The specific embodiment
Embodiment 1 is as Fig. 1, Fig. 2 and shown in Figure 3, this porcelain granule bath device comprises cast iron bathtub 1 and heating plant, the casing wall bottom of bathtub is provided with a plurality of heat supply through holes 3 and exhaust hole 4, heating plant comprises hot-air blower 2 and aerator 5, the heat supply through hole is communicated with the exhaust outlet 7 of hot-air blower by heat supplying pipeline 6, and exhaust hole is communicated with the air inlet 8 of hot-air blower by gas exhaust piping 14, cold air enters hot-air blower by the air inlet of hot-air blower, after hot-air blower is heated to be hot-air, exhaust outlet output by hot-air blower, and be conveyed in the heat supplying pipeline through aerator, bath layer of sand in hot-air and the bathtub is through after the exchange heat, again through exhaust hole, the air inlet of gas exhaust piping and hot-air blower reenters hot-air blower, and this heating plant can be three bathtub heat supplies simultaneously.Above-mentioned bathtub top be provided with can by the slide fastener closure or openness, by the thermal insulation cover 9 of thermal isolation film preparation, and around the network-like heating plant of being made up of the heat supply water pipe 10 is set, bathtub outer wall of cylinder block and heating plant all are coated in the heat-insulation layer 11 that is formed by materials such as high density foams on the bathtub outer wall of cylinder block.In addition, the top of the casing wall of this bathtub is provided with a water inlet 12, and the bottom of described bathtub is provided with outlet 13, and bathtub is placed on the pedestal 20.Above-mentioned network-like heating plant also can be made of the heat supply cable, and heat-insulation layer can be made by the insulation heat-barrier material.
The using method of this porcelain granule bath device is as follows:
A. pack in the bathtub in porcelain granule bath device and bathe layer of sand 15, and the thermal insulation cover on the bathtub 9 is closed;
B. start the heating plant in the porcelain granule bath device, and pass through heat supplying pipeline 6 and in bathtub 1, import hot-air, behind hot-air and the bath layer of sand heat-shift, air inlet through steam vent, gas exhaust piping and heating plant enters heating plant successively, export in the bathtub once more after treating to be heated again, be heated to 40~55 ℃ to bathing layer of sand, stop heating;
C. open thermal insulation cover, inject hot water or steam about 40~55 ℃ in the heat abstractor that on the bathtub casing wall, is provided with simultaneously, make user lie, carry out haydite and bathe into bathtub;
D. after haydite is bathed and finished, open the water inlet that is provided with on the bathtub casing wall, the input clean water cleans bathing layer of sand in bathtub, behind to be cleaned the finishing, opens the outlet of bath base, and sewage is discharged, and repeats this cleaning operation repeatedly, is cleaned until bathing layer of sand;
E. the operation of repeating step a, layer of sand is completely dried to bathing, and is heated to 40~55 ℃, then the operation in repeating step b, c, d and this step.
In the present embodiment, used bath layer of sand mainly is made up of the haydite that the volcanic rock material constitutes, and these haydites are ganoid spheroidal, and particle diameter is all about 0.2~0.5cm.
